A land of amazing variety, of crumbling Portuguese churches, misty mountains, pristine reefs, translucent seas rich with fish, and an inspiring people who wouldn't accept anything less than an independent homeland. Experience the pleasures and treasures of the world's newest nation with the first guidebook since independence this is your ticket to a brandnew journey. CONNECT WITH THE PRESENT East Timor's President Xanana Gusmo writes about independence UNDERSTAND THE PAST our comprehensive History chapter puts you in the picture PLAN YOUR JOURNEY with our Highlights and Itineraries sections BLAZE YOUR OWN TRAIL with detailed maps, including customized itineraries maps and fullcolor regional map TALK THE TALK Tetun and Indonesian language chapter
